STUYVESANT PARK RESIDENCE

Private Client | New York, New York

This 1860s five story townhouse in a landmarked district was renovated to a two family residence. The main goal for the renovation was to orient the cellar and first floor levels to the garden. AMBA worked closely with the NYC Landmarks Preservation Commission to achieve compliance and approvals for the exterior work.

A full, eat-in kitchen with custom cabinetry was created with a glass door and French casement window that allow physical and visual connections to the outdoors. An open stair connects the first floor living room to the new kitchen. Existing windows and masonry were removed in the living room to create floor-to-ceiling glazing. A new wood and steel balcony is detailed with cable connections to the structural wall.

The renovation was phased to accommodate both the client’s financial requirements and staged occupancy of the residence..
